Israeli Strike in South Lebanon Claims Life of Child and Woman in Latest Incident of Violence

Lebanese capital area: According to local rescuers and official media, a lady and a daughter from the same family were killed in an Israeli attack on Tuesday in the southern region of Lebanon. This area has been the site of frequent fire exchanges between Israel and the Hezbollah organization, which is supported by Iran.
The raid is in response to Hezbollah’s previous claim that it attacked Israeli sites in the north using drones, which Israel characterized as a “significant” hit.

An individual in the civil defense informed AFP that “a woman in her 50s and a 12-year-old girl have been killed” as a result of an Israeli attack. Several members of the same family were wounded and sent to hospitals.

Reports indicate that a mother and her young kid were murdered, along with “six others wounded in an enemy air strike on a house in Hanin,” which is close to the Israeli border, according to Lebanon’s National News Agency (NNA).

“A family that had not left… since Israeli attacks started” lived in the two-story home that was “totally destroyed” when “enemy warplanes carried out a raid, firing two air-to-surface missiles and destroying it,” according to the NA.

Since October 7th, Hamas assaults on Israel have sparked war in Gaza, and near-daily battles ensued, displacing tens of thousands on both sides of the Israel-Lebanon border.

Recent days have seen an increase in rocket assaults on Israeli positions by Hezbollah, with the most recent attack going beyond the typical border region.

Israel denied that their targets were struck in a previous statement from Hezbollah, which claimed to have carried out “a combined air attack using decoy and explosive drones that targeted” two Israeli sites north of Acre.

One of their members was murdered earlier in the day in south Lebanon in an Israeli drone strike, the Lebanese group said, adding that the assault was “in response” to that.

“We successfully intercepted two suspicious aerial targets off the northern coast,” the Israeli army said.

According to Hezbollah, an Israeli airstrike killed one of its members on Tuesday morning. The militant was a local citizen whose car was hit.

According to an AFP source close to the Iran-backed organization, an engineer serving in the group’s air defense forces was killed in a vehicle crash caused by an Israeli drone attack deep inside Lebanon.

According to an AFP journalist, the attack occurred in the Abu al-Aswad neighborhood, which is close to the seaside city of Tyre and around 35 kilometers (22 miles) from the border.

Everything on the fighter’s vehicle was burned to ash.

Another fighter was slain by Israel, Hezbollah announced in an overnight statement.

“Two significant terrorists in Hezbollah’s aerial unit” were reportedly killed in nighttime and early attacks by the Israeli army earlier Tuesday.

The terrorist leader assassinated on Tuesday was “heavily involved in the planning and execution of terrorist attacks against Israel,” according to the statement.

Approximately 380 individuals have lost their lives in Lebanon since October 7, with 72 of those casualties being civilians and the majority being Hezbollah combatants, as reported by AFP.

On their side of the border, Israel reports the deaths of eight civilians and eleven troops.
